How Does It Work?
This isn't flashcards. This isn't drilling. Math Games Kids is a play-based method that teaches your child's brain what numbers actually mean — through touch, movement, and real objects. Developed with child development research that shows: children learn math through their hands first, their heads second.
Here's how it works:
✅ Step 1: Connect Numbers to Objects
Your child learns that '5' isn't just a word — it means five real things they can hold
✅ Step 2: Build One-to-One Understanding
Through counting games with physical objects, your child learns to match one number to one thing — the foundation that turns reciting into real counting.
✅ Step 3: Develop Quantity Sense
Sorting, grouping, and comparing games teach your child to see which group has more, which has less — without counting every time. This is the "number sense" that school math is built on.
✅ Step 4: Practice Simple Problem-Solving
Fun challenges like 'share 6 blocks equally between two cups' or 'you had 5, gave away 2 — how many left?
